CHICAGO – Chicago police are searching for a suspect wanted in a recent double homicide in the Greater Grand Crossing neighborhood.
Police released a photo of a Black man, approximately 16–22 years old, wearing a dark-colored hooded sweater and dark-colored pants.
Around 11:18 p.m., police say the suspect was involved in a double homicide in the 7800 block of South Calumet Avenue on March 24.
